[发明专利]消息获取的方法及装置有效
申请号: | 201710540980.8 | 申请日: | 2017-07-04 |
公开(公告)号: | CN107133116B | 公开(公告)日: | 2020-08-11 |
发明(设计)人: | 贺竟峥 | 申请(专利权)人: | 北京像素软件科技股份有限公司 |
主分类号: | G06F9/54 | 分类号: | G06F9/54 |
代理公司: | 北京超凡志成知识产权代理事务所(普通合伙) 11371 | 代理人: | 王术兰 |
地址: | 102200 北京市昌平区*** | 国省代码: | 北京;11 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 消息 获取 方法 装置 | ||
本发明提供了一种消息获取的方法及装置,属于互联网领域。该方法包括:获取多个通信模块中的一个通信模块发送的请求,当判断该请求发生错误时,发送错误码给多个通信模块,其中,多个通信模块共用一套消息定义文件,该消息定义文件包括错误码定义文件和提示信息定义文件。通过该消息获取的方法及装置以方便消息处理的统一管理,出现问题能及时定位,提高相互之间的协作。
技术领域
本发明涉及互联网领域,具体而言,涉及一种消息获取的方法及装置。
背景技术
当开发人员在开发在进行游戏、EAP等各种系统的开发时,难免要处理很多消息的显示,需要提示使用者当前使用系统所在的状态。特别是一些错误码的处理,能让我们清晰的知道问题所在。
现在对游戏、EAP等进行系统开发时,一般的做法是每个模块都自定义一套自己的返回码,例如,服务器的开发人员进行返回码返回,并自己打印服务器log,客户端拿到返回码,跟服务器人员协商后进行相应的tip提示,但是这些都是在每个模块的小范围定义,虽然这样比较灵活,开发效率高,但是,如果客户端和服务器人员不在同一地点或同一时间协作,就比较麻烦。
发明内容
有鉴于此,本发明实施例的目的在于提供一种消息获取的方法及装置,以方便消息处理的统一管理,出现问题能及时定位,提高相互之间的协作。
第一方面,本发明实施例提供了一种消息获取的方法,所述方法包括获取多个通信模块中的一个所述通信模块发送的请求;当判断所述请求发生错误时,发送错误码给所述多个通信模块,其中,所述多个通信模块共用一套消息定义文件,所述消息定义文件包括错误码定义文件和提示信息定义文件。
在本发明较佳的实施例中,上述获取多个通信模块中的一个所述通信模块发送的请求之前,还包括:获取所述多个通信模块的公共信息单元和所述多个通信模块中的每个所述通信模块的单独信息单元;将所述多个通信模块的公共信息单元和每个所述通信模块的单独信息单元相关联。
在本发明较佳的实施例中,上述方法还包括:当判断所述公共信息单元和所述单独信息单元都发生错误时,优先发送所述单独信息单元对应的错误码给所述多个通信模块。
在本发明较佳的实施例中,上述消息定位文件设置有一级目录、二级目录以及三级目录,所述二级目录为所述一级目录的子目录,所述三级目录为所述二级目录的子目录,其中,所述一级目录为所述消息定义文件的总目录,所述二级目录根据语言进行划分,所述三级目录根据所述公共信息单元和所述单独信息单元进行划分。
在本发明较佳的实施例中,上述多个通信模块包括服务器模块、客户端模块以及数据库模块中的至少两个。
第二方面,本发明实施例提供了一种消息获取的装置,所述装置包括:请求获取模块,用于获取所述多个通信模块中的一个所述通信模块发送的请求;第一判断模块,用于当判断所述请求发生错误时,发送错误码给所述多个通信模块,其中,所述多个通信模块公用一套消息定义文件,所述消息定义文件包括错误码定义文件和提示信息定义文件。
在本发明较佳的实施例中,上述装置还包括:信息获取模块,用于获取所述多个通信模块的公共信息单元和所述多个通信模块中的每个所述通信模块的单独信息单元;关联模块,用于将所述多个通信模块的公共信息单元和每个所述通信模块的单独信息单元相关联。
在本发明较佳的实施例中,上述装置还包括:第二判断模块,用于当判断所述公共信息单元和所述单独信息单元都发生错误时,优先发送所述单独信息单元对应的错误码给所述多个通信模块。
在本发明较佳的实施例中,上述消息定位文件设置有一级目录、二级目录以及三级目录,所述二级目录为所述一级目录的子目录,所述三级目录为所述二级目录的子目录,其中,所述一级目录为所述消息定义文件的总目录,所述二级目录根据语言进行划分,所述三级目录根据公共信息单元和单独信息单元进行划分。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于北京像素软件科技股份有限公司,未经北京像素软件科技股份有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201710540980.8/2.html,转载请声明来源钻瓜专利网。
- 上一篇:多级级联式自平衡系留无人机系统
- 下一篇:一种具有双旋翼系统的多旋翼无人机